3] Michael Penix Jr, Indiana
"Penix's upside is so high that Peyton Ramsey decided to enter the transfer portal last month. In 6 starts last season, the Fla. native completed 69% of his passes for 1394 yds., 10TD's & 4 INT's. He also rushed for 119 yds. & 2 scores on 22 carries. Penix got hurt prematurely ending his season for the 2nd straight yr. That's the only worry with this playmaker--can he last a full season? Coach Tom Allen said last fall Penix had a very bright future at Indiana & most believe that begins in a few months from now for a bowl team in the Big Ten."
